Transaction 71a66d5ecf9cb0309aa42fa971535bd7504e1e99572488367c9622a359105957
1 Input
1 Output
-
71a66d5ecf9cb0309aa42fa971535bd7504e1e99572488367c9622a359105957:0
- value
- 3195776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d78fa17987036106a4c227cb5f039763bb83d66 OP_EQUAL
- address
- 3LRTNVYTsw81m3LkcJ6K1JFCX2CTScKviw